Heaven’s future in jeopardy amid reports of £320k rent increase

Heaven nightclub, an iconic London venue for the LGBTQIA+ community, is facing a potential rent increase of £320,000. It has been reported that the landlord, The Arch Company, has requested an additional £240,000 per year increase, in addition to the £80,000 rise that was requested in September 2020. Music industry calls on Jeremy Hunt to cut VAT rates for financially squeezed venues

The UK music industry is calling on Chancellor Jeremy Hunt to reduce VAT rates for venues ahead of the spring budget. UK Music, which represents British music performers, producers and others in the sector, wants the 20% VAT rates on gig tickets to be cut in half.
